Common Ground (2014)

It tells the story of Dennis, whose musician brother Oli is missing. Dennis is not the only person looking for him. Oli’s ex-wife, the members of his band and the local moneylenders are all on the lookout for Oli too. And tramps have moved into Oli’s flat. With Oli nowhere to be found, Dennis inherits a whole set of problems that threaten both him and his family… Set against the backdrop of the contemporary economic crisis and the anti-government protests of late 2011, Common Ground is a neonoir film about family, identity, economics and the dream of utopia.
